My second wife had that problem and it was hurting her jaw muscles real bad at the time we had a great DR. he prescribed a mouth guard and it worked, they were fitted by the DR. and it was expensive even with insurance! Now they have them at CVS and Walgreens for about $12.00 and you can do them your self. I think they're called niteguard! if the name is not correct ask and they'll know about them. It took a little getting used to but her jaw would hurt her all day and that motivated her to use it! Good Luck! tdemex
